Claims (1)

Способ получения пленочных полимерных нанокомпозиций обработкой полимерной композиции, состоящей из поливинилового спирта, воды и смеси водорастворимых солей трех- и двухвалентного железа, водным раствором щелочи при введении щелочи в количестве, по крайней мере, обеспечивающем полное протекание реакции щелочного гидролиза смеси солей железа с образованием смеси магнетита и магемита, отличающийся тем, что перед обработкой водным раствором щелочи полимерную композицию обрабатывают, по крайней мере, одним водорастворимым диальдегидом при рН 0 - 3 в присутствии кислоты в качестве подкисляющего агента.A method for producing film polymer nanocomposites by treating a polymer composition consisting of polyvinyl alcohol, water and a mixture of water-soluble salts of ferric and ferrous iron with an aqueous alkali solution when alkali is introduced in an amount at least that ensures the complete alkaline hydrolysis of the mixture of iron salts to form a mixture magnetite and magemite, characterized in that before treatment with an aqueous alkali solution, the polymer composition is treated with at least one water-soluble dialdehyde at a pH of 0 - 3 in the presence of acid as acidifying agent.
